区块链共识协议详解:让你深入了解不同共识机

        
                
                    ## 内容主体大纲 1.

                    引言

                    - 区块链的核心理念 - 共识协议的重要性 2.

                    共识协议的基本概念

                    区块链共识协议详解:让你深入了解不同共识机制的优劣 - 什么是共识协议 - 共识协议的功能和作用 3.

                    常见的区块链共识协议类型

                    - 工作量证明(PoW) - 权益证明(PoS) - 委任权益证明(DPoS) - 拜占庭容错(BFT)机制 4.

                    工作量证明 (PoW)

                    区块链共识协议详解:让你深入了解不同共识机制的优劣 - PoW的基本原理 - 优缺点分析 - 典型实例(比特币) 5.

                    权益证明 (PoS)

                    - PoS的基本原理 - 当前应用与优势 - 典型实例(以太坊2.0) 6.

                    委任权益证明 (DPoS)

                    - DPoS的机制及其创新之处 - 优劣对比 - 典型实例(EOS) 7.

                    拜占庭容错 (BFT) 机制

                    - BFT的由来和应用 - 实际运用的场景 - 典型实例(Hyperledger) 8.

                    其他共识机制的介绍

                    - 权益混合证明(Hybrid PoW/PoS) - 局部共识机制(Local Consensus) - DAG(有向无环图)技术 9.

                    共识协议的未来趋势

                    - 解决现有问题的必要性 - 新兴技术的发展(例如量子计算) 10.

                    总结

                    - 各种共识协议的综合对比 - 用户根据需求选择合适的协议 --- ## 引言

                    在区块链技术发展的浪潮中,共识协议就像是秩序的守护者。它不仅仅是几个代码的堆砌,而是构成整个区块链系统运作基础的核心机制。随着数字资产和去中心化应用的不断增加,了解不同的共识协议成为了越来越多开发者和投资者的必修课。

                    ## 共识协议的基本概念

                    共识协议,简单来说,就是网络中各个节点达成一致意见的方法。在区块链中,所有参与者需要就状态(例如账户余额)的改变达成一致,以确保数据的安全性和一致性。这种机制正是区块链技术去中心化的重要保证。

                    共识协议的功能主要体现在以下几个方面:确保交易的有效性,防止双重支付攻击,维护网络的稳定性,保护用户的权益等。不同的共识协议在实现这些功能的方法上各有特点,本文将深入探讨几种常见的共识机制。

                    ## 常见的区块链共识协议类型

                    现有的区块链共识协议种类繁多,但主要可以归纳为几大类:工作量证明(PoW)、权益证明(PoS)、委任权益证明(DPoS)和拜占庭容错(BFT)机制。每种协议都有自己的设计理念和使用场景。

                    ## 工作量证明 (PoW)

                    工作量证明(PoW)是第一个被广泛应用的共识机制,最著名的实现是比特币。在这种机制下,节点(矿工)通过竞争解决复杂的数学问题来获得权利,参与区块的创建和验证。

                    这种机制的优点在于其强大的安全性,由于需要消耗大量计算资源,安全性得以保障。然而,PoW也存在一些缺点,比如高能耗和网络拥堵等问题。随着时代的进步,其他共识机制逐渐涌现出来,试图解决这些问题。

                    ## 权益证明 (PoS)

                    权益证明(PoS)作为对PoW的一种替代方案,以持币数量和持有时间为基础,选出验证者。而不是依靠算力,PoS通过激励机制鼓励用户保持他们的币,网络通过这种方式确保安全性。

                    这种机制的优点在于其能源效率,降低了对硬件的依赖,同时也避免了对高能耗计算的需求。以太坊在向其2.0版的过渡中,就是采用了PoS机制,实现了安全与环保的结合。

                    ## 委任权益证明 (DPoS)

                    委任权益证明(DPoS)一开始是为了解决权益证明的一些局限性,它通过选举代表来进行区块的生产和确认。这种方法使得网络的效率大大提高,因为只需要少数节点来进行验证。

                    DPoS机制的优点在于其高效性和快速确认时间,但缺点也是显而易见的:可能导致中心化,因多数权力掌握在少数节点手中。EOS是DPoS的成功案例之一。

                    ## 拜占庭容错 (BFT) 机制

                    拜占庭容错(BFT)机制最适合于在少数节点之间达成共识的场景。其设计目标在于防止恶意节点的攻击,确保即使在少数节点失效或者不可信的情况下,网络仍能正常运作。

                    BFT机制在企业级应用中非常有用,如Hyperledger等项目,通过这种机制,不仅提高了交易的安全性,同时确保了数据的不可篡改性。这种机制适合于需要高安全性和可监管性的应用场景。

                    ## 其他共识机制的介绍

                    除了上述常见的共识协议,近年来还有一些新兴机制受到关注。例如,权益混合证明(Hybrid PoW/PoS)将PoW与PoS的优势结合起来,试图在不同于纯粹PoW或PoS的基础上,创建出更为安全和高效的系统。

                    DAG(有向无环图)技术是一种分布式账本技术,利用图结构的方式避免了传统区块链中“区块链”的延迟问题,实现快速交易确认。这些新技术的探索,将推动区块链的发展,未来可能带来新的解决方案。

                    ## 共识协议的未来趋势

                    随着技术的不断进步,深入识别各类共识协议的优缺点变得愈加重要。比方说,量子计算的逐渐成熟,未来可能会改变现有共识协议的安全性,甚至是构建新的机制。在保持去中心化的同时,如何实现更高的安全性和性能,成为了未来区块链技术迫切需要解决的问题。

                    ## 总结

                    不同的共识协议各有特色,用户应根据自身的需求和场景选择合适的协议。无论是追求安全性、效率,还是可扩展性,各种共识协议为区块链技术的发展提供了多样化的解决方案。随着技术的不断演进,真相是——区块链的未来将是一个不断创新和发展的过程。

                              author

                              Appnox App

                              content here', making it look like readable English. Many desktop publishing is packages and web page editors now use

                                              related post

                                                leave a reply

                                                    <strong dir="bsh"></strong><del draggable="8pk"></del><bdo dir="0e4"></bdo><area dir="id2"></area><area draggable="y8q"></area><ol dir="0oa"></ol><code dir="3eh"></code><u dir="449"></u><tt dropzone="8i1"></tt><kbd id="t_i"></kbd>